Transaction e2aa3958f178ce5af1649955fb7094904fe81423ecd44a4dc8554ba7f8d800dd

3 Input
2 Outputs
  • e2aa3958f178ce5af1649955fb7094904fe81423ecd44a4dc8554ba7f8d800dd:0
  • value  999602
    address  3CAD6rWa55skX9Ro5RAPhjvgx6kXFBDmz7
  • e2aa3958f178ce5af1649955fb7094904fe81423ecd44a4dc8554ba7f8d800dd:1
  • value  5878749
    address  32YiJLkSo8FoneviMXtTsX7MgegbRHzDcQ